Received: by 2002:a25:1985:0:0:0:0:0 with SMTP id 127csp1516531ybz; Thu, 30 Apr 2020 00:20:49 -0700 (PDT) X-Google-Smtp-Source: APiQypLdBWzO2UMnZQHFv3e50XAPquByiiiIm/o/G6ephWT8SY/OtWBS15IWfMtErADFl1Sef0pI X-Received: by 2002:a05:6402:b4c:: with SMTP id bx12mr1450430edb.247.1588231249389; Thu, 30 Apr 2020 00:20:49 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1588231249; cv=none; d=google.com; s=arc-20160816; b=R9TlCn+VSuyj+xhJcUpNDmNh7Az/Tq73nnPJhOXt4tm/dRpZP2yQu4yiZiDRLdSHPw 8/NZWOAiHmhjYUGriq02V8cjCzdK1aVSr7D3Ep0UDWJM84vAzYnMPC4rcRdxY35eXJiY q3dvmmBT072Q9XRxeMYzhW2b9CBOSQX8dafwFKyfnc0j0hkDiTk1CYYLPO/bZVXONJR6 PR374dChZvGPGdQ/tcK0Wy08PaGU9cwE6BNv/JfCKySz8WsQIcmNcJRhhmXkvfvRoTiO LXFcKc5BGrK5Iro9bTEjE12goPv9OALm1ksRrpH2doJSr9oHIRuBLBnFIUyS38zfrCbp YIIw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:mime-version:content-transfer-encoding :content-language:accept-language:in-reply-to:references:message-id :deferred-delivery:date:thread-index:cc:to:from:thread-topic:subject :ironport-sdr:dkim-signature; bh=49aIoMJfZD48Zv0jPVQLv85WcEcgrU7KH5esWay/qvU=; b=uyeZ6HIGR+JhteMWTgyw1U0TqifdaZ5tUQ4/dJT7IteZB9eiuyyFUDz2b5jzZvt/Vn 44Wzg/w7An+6rjkPdSlp0PO1QQt2skbumYixkeayqk6kvHBWEgmendUmirsmTvdhC+Pp 6nUYAMx/oM7GxFU1Un4n6jUuUwxlh2DyiWzTBBVMuwRcGl9s6Eb1jJmMDP9eFIAV6MUm H//ARNrkNznEIbY+UQrtmnpSA1wZNRt7AbKOuFCjoIuoedNfu/TV+cAvJ9sjoGoFgqJq XjuGlQLnAlQCiSflsu3Nk/Lemdxup3az3Ju19fEhJPINWaW3perJodDmfmaXIf8VyES6 rsSA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@amazon.com header.s=amazon201209 header.b=k9p0pKH4;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=amazon.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id fi25si5408534ejb.25.2020.04.30.00.20.25; Thu, 30 Apr 2020 00:20:49 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@amazon.com header.s=amazon201209 header.b=k9p0pKH4;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=amazon.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726554AbgD3HTJ (ORCPT + 99 others); Thu, 30 Apr 2020 03:19:09 -0400 Received: from smtp-fw-2101.amazon.com ([72.21.196.25]:29355 "EHLO smtp-fw-2101.amazon.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726337AbgD3HTI (ORCPT ); Thu, 30 Apr 2020 03:19:08 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=amazon.com; i=@amazon.com; q=dns/txt; s=amazon201209; t=1588231148; x=1619767148; h=from:to:cc:date:message-id:references:in-reply-to: content-transfer-encoding:mime-version:subject; bh=49aIoMJfZD48Zv0jPVQLv85WcEcgrU7KH5esWay/qvU=; b=k9p0pKH4TREqaVe8zrqwDzlFUwLiLxKchOuetK7CF0J//NCXcamDuCm8 ZR2BGIg8ehrmuh0zk0zLpyTGyGZjJtxBgmr5xE9Ms1xSNbM0WgbLerhDb 0HvCbGwk0WzvsX485Q+AkQf9zMhx56uR12aoKT7GkDyhcYZP4qB5UTb/t 0=; IronPort-SDR: IlHjtA3eOb1l09Nb+e8NXZtuMd9Wiq/R1iYFI7f9hxls5nYp7ejSi19bXNpDrn8BE53sgkv4uZ 5KZImaeRH56Q== X-IronPort-AV: E=Sophos;i="5.73,334,1583193600"; d="scan'208";a="28239627" Subject: RE: [PATCH] net: ena: fix gcc-4.8 missing-braces warning Thread-Topic: [PATCH] net: ena: fix gcc-4.8 missing-braces warning Received: from iad12-co-svc-p1-lb1-vlan2.amazon.com (HELO email-inbound-relay-1d-9ec21598.us-east-1.amazon.com) ([10.43.8.2]) by smtp-border-fw-out-2101.iad2.amazon.com with ESMTP; 30 Apr 2020 07:18:55 +0000 Received: from EX13MTAUEA002.ant.amazon.com (iad55-ws-svc-p15-lb9-vlan3.iad.amazon.com [10.40.159.166]) by email-inbound-relay-1d-9ec21598.us-east-1.amazon.com (Postfix) with ESMTPS id 86C5FA1D38; Thu, 30 Apr 2020 07:18:52 +0000 (UTC) Received: from EX13D08EUC003.ant.amazon.com (10.43.164.232) by EX13MTAUEA002.ant.amazon.com (10.43.61.77) with Microsoft SMTP Server (TLS) id 15.0.1497.2; Thu, 30 Apr 2020 07:18:51 +0000 Received: from EX13D11EUC003.ant.amazon.com (10.43.164.153) by EX13D08EUC003.ant.amazon.com (10.43.164.232) with Microsoft SMTP Server (TLS) id 15.0.1497.2; Thu, 30 Apr 2020 07:18:50 +0000 Received: from EX13D11EUC003.ant.amazon.com ([10.43.164.153]) by EX13D11EUC003.ant.amazon.com ([10.43.164.153]) with mapi id 15.00.1497.006; Thu, 30 Apr 2020 07:18:50 +0000 From: "Jubran, Samih" To: Arnd Bergmann , "Belgazal, Netanel" , "Kiyanovski, Arthur" , "David S. Miller" , Alexei Starovoitov , Daniel Borkmann , Jakub Kicinski , "Jesper Dangaard Brouer" , John Fastabend CC: "Tzalik, Guy" , "Bshara, Saeed" , "Machulsky, Zorik" , "netdev@vger.kernel.org" , "linux-kernel@vger.kernel.org" , "bpf@vger.kernel.org" Thread-Index: AQHWHadH74VL29pWn0eLulmochhjwKiRPQvg Date: Thu, 30 Apr 2020 07:18:47 +0000 Deferred-Delivery: Thu, 30 Apr 2020 07:17:49 +0000 Message-ID: <03f3568ec8c646cdb7c767b16d19525a@EX13D11EUC003.ant.amazon.com> References: <20200428215131.3948527-1-arnd@arndb.de> In-Reply-To: <20200428215131.3948527-1-arnd@arndb.de> Accept-Language: en-US Content-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: x-ms-exchange-transport-fromentityheader: Hosted x-originating-ip: [10.43.164.46]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able MIME-Version: 1.0 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org > -----Original Message----- > From: Arnd Bergmann > Sent: Wednesday, April 29, 2020 12:51 AM > To: Belgazal, Netanel ; Kiyanovski, Arthur > ; David S. Miller ; Alexei > Starovoitov ; Daniel Borkmann ; > Jakub Kicinski ; Jesper Dangaard Brouer > ; John Fastabend ; Jubran, > Samih > Cc: Arnd Bergmann ; Tzalik, Guy ; > Bshara, Saeed ; Machulsky, Zorik > ; netdev@vger.kernel.org; linux- > kernel@vger.kernel.org; bpf@vger.kernel.org > Subject: [EXTERNAL] [PATCH] net: ena: fix gcc-4.8 missing-braces warning >=20 > CAUTION: This email originated from outside of the organization. Do not c= lick > links or open attachments unless you can confirm the sender and know the > content is safe. >=20 >=20 >=20 > Older compilers warn about initializers with incorrect curly > braces: >=20 > drivers/net/ethernet/amazon/ena/ena_netdev.c: In function > 'ena_xdp_xmit_buff': > drivers/net/ethernet/amazon/ena/ena_netdev.c:311:2: error: expected ',' > or ';' before 'struct' > struct ena_tx_buffer *tx_info; > ^~~~~~ > drivers/net/ethernet/amazon/ena/ena_netdev.c:321:2: error: 'tx_info' > undeclared (first use in this function) > tx_info =3D &xdp_ring->tx_buffer_info[req_id]; > ^~~~~~~ > drivers/net/ethernet/amazon/ena/ena_netdev.c:321:2: note: each > undeclared identifier is reported only once for each function it appears = in >=20 > Use the GNU empty initializer extension to avoid this. >=20 > Fixes: 31aa9857f173 ("net: ena: enable negotiating larger Rx ring size") Please use the correct fixes, it should be XDP TX commit. Otherwise looks good, Thanks! > Signed-off-by: Arnd Bergmann > --- > drivers/net/ethernet/amazon/ena/ena_netdev.c |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) >=20 > diff --git a/drivers/net/ethernet/amazon/ena/ena_netdev.c > b/drivers/net/ethernet/amazon/ena/ena_netdev.c > index 2cc765df8da3..ad385652ca24 100644 > --- a/drivers/net/ethernet/amazon/ena/ena_netdev.c > +++ b/drivers/net/ethernet/amazon/ena/ena_netdev.c > @@ -307,7 +307,7 @@ static int ena_xdp_xmit_buff(struct net_device *dev, > struct ena_rx_buffer *rx_info) { > struct ena_adapter *adapter =3D netdev_priv(dev); > - struct ena_com_tx_ctx ena_tx_ctx =3D {0}; > + struct ena_com_tx_ctx ena_tx_ctx =3D { }; > struct ena_tx_buffer *tx_info; > struct ena_ring *xdp_ring; > u16 next_to_use, req_id; > -- > 2.26.0